Here in the USA when carbon fuel tanks first came out some people got them because of the claimed weight savings, but almost every time a bike with a carbon tank crashed at the race track the tank would abrade though and it would catch the bike on fire when the leaking fuel made contact with the hot metal parts of the bike. I don't know of anyone here that runs a carbon tank anymore - maybe the MotoGP guys know something better - also Rossi never did crash much.
